I'm gonna say no, as the msm7627 is a 600mhz arm6 processor and it only supports opengl 1.1. Of the devices that are listed on virgin mobiles website, the Evo V will work, it's a rebranded Evo 3D, and the Optimus Elite may, I can't vouch for it without looking up the specs.

Hey Ono I would say no it won't with reasons descriped by Death. I have always had a VM phone since 2000 and have owned most of their phones. A couple of months ago I upgraded to the Motorola Triumph from the LG Optimus V knowing the Optimus V could not play DL and WoM given its small 600 mhz armv6 processor. VM just got the HTC Evo V (Evo 3D 4G) which I'm getting this Friday because it comes with a 1.2 ghz processor and 4G for just 35$ a month. So if I was you and you wanna play PL DL and maybe AL coming soon you might wanna try to get a Triumph or better to play their newer games. Have you tried looking into the LG Optimus Elite or the HTC Wildfire S they both come with a 800 mhz processor but I don't know if their armv6 or armv7 processors?

EDIT: Just did research on the Optimus Elite and Wildfire S and they both come with armv6 processors so they can't play DL if you want a VM phone looks like your going to have to get a Triumph or Evo V since their the only VM phones that come with a armv7 processor which is required to play DL. If you still want to get a VM that's not a Triumph or Evo V you will only beable to play PL and SL with them.

Is a 600 MHz Processor an armv7 or armv6 im actually confused.And upset i wont be able to have a phone that plays DL and Pl.

Processor speed doesn't have anything to do with it.

Edit: well, it may somewhat, but when we're discussing armX whatever, we are talking about instruction sets, how the cpu handles the info given to it.
